Dating Confidence Reset
Start small and clear: name one outcome you want from conversations this week — practice, casual chatting, or a potential date. When your goal is specific, it’s easier to spot progress and avoid feeling aimless.
Set realistic expectations. Online dating is a process, not a single test. Expect some matches to fizzle and some conversations to click. That doesn’t reflect your worth; it’s part of finding someone whose rhythm fits yours.
Pace conversations with intention. Match the other person’s tempo early on: slow down if responses are brief, or mirror a slightly quicker rhythm if they show warmth and effort. Move to voice or video calls when you feel steady, not because a timeline says you should.
Choose quality over quantity. Instead of swiping endlessly, spend a little more time on profiles that genuinely interest you. Write one thoughtful opening line or question — it increases the chance of a real reply and saves you energy.
Track small wins. Celebrate a clear conversation, a laugh shared, or a plan made — these are signs of forward motion. Keeping a simple record (even a note on your phone) helps you see patterns and keeps discouragement from building.
Practice calm self-respect. If someone ghosts, cancels last minute, or crosses a boundary, treat it as information about them, not a verdict on you. Politely step away from interactions that drain you and protect time for activities that restore your confidence.
Be curious, not desperate. Ask open questions that reveal values and daily life. Curiosity keeps conversations grounded and helps you assess compatibility without overinvesting emotionally too soon.
Adjust as you learn. After a few conversations, reflect briefly: Is your goal still the same? Are you attracting the type of people you want? Small tweaks to your profile, photos, or opening lines can change the quality of matches.
